How is DA Decided?
The Dearness Allowance (DA) and Dearness Relief (DR) hikes are calculated based on inflation trends and the All India Consumer Price Index (AICPI).
- The AICPI 12-month average determines the percentage increase.
- The government reviews DA twice a year (January & July).
- Official announcements are typically made in March and September each year.
